Noun
prep school (plural prep schools)
- (US) A private or public school intended to prepare its students to get into prestigious universities.
- (British) A private primary school which prepares its pupils for the common entrance examination most commonly at the age of thirteen, and subsequent entry into public school.
- Synonym: prepper
